国产一级a片免费看高清,亚洲熟女中文字幕在线视频,黄三级高清在线播放,免费黄色视频在线看

打開APP
userphoto
未登錄

開通VIP,暢享免費(fèi)電子書等14項(xiàng)超值服

開通VIP
VMware ThinApp簡明教程

VMware ThinApp簡明教程:制作單文件軟件和便攜軟件

VMware ThinApp是一款應(yīng)用程序虛擬化工具,但對(duì)于我來說用的更多的是制作單文件軟件和便攜軟件。

VMware ThinApp將程序相關(guān)資源如exe、dll、ocx、注冊(cè)表項(xiàng)等封裝到單一的EXE文件中,程序運(yùn)行時(shí)需要的資源也都從這個(gè)單EXE的虛擬環(huán)境中,從而實(shí)現(xiàn)與操作系統(tǒng)的隔離。

借助VMware ThinApp的封裝可以制作比較純正的單文件軟件,而簡單設(shè)置參數(shù)后,VMware ThinApp也能充當(dāng)制作便攜軟件的角色,大部分情況下,VMware ThinApp也確實(shí)能出色的工作。

之前一直想做一個(gè)簡單的ThinApp使用教程,不過總是沒堅(jiān)持下來,這次借著新版VMware ThinApp的發(fā)布就先整理出一個(gè)制作思路來吧,希望能與大家共同探討學(xué)習(xí)下。不過現(xiàn)在我還是不太喜歡單文件軟件了,尤其是ThinApp封裝的,更傾向于綠色軟件、便攜軟件和免安裝軟件。

1. 首先運(yùn)行程序Setup Capture.exe ,ThinApp會(huì)以向?qū)J酵瓿沙绦虼虬?,點(diǎn)擊Next繼續(xù)。

2. 這里簡單介紹了注意事項(xiàng),最主要的就是在一個(gè)干凈的系統(tǒng)上掃描形成系統(tǒng)快照,好處就是能得到程序正常運(yùn)行所需要的最多信息。

如需要自定義掃描配置,點(diǎn)擊Advanced settings… ,這里可以設(shè)置需要掃描的驅(qū)動(dòng)器和注冊(cè)表分支,設(shè)定好之后確定返回。

3. 點(diǎn)擊Next后ThinApp會(huì)以掃描當(dāng)前文件系統(tǒng)和注冊(cè)表并形成一個(gè)快照,ThinApp正在保存快照:

待系統(tǒng)快照完成之后,VMware ThinApp會(huì)給出提示,即開始安裝并配置好你需要封裝的程序,建議將程序安裝到默認(rèn)位置。一切完成之后點(diǎn)擊Next繼續(xù):

4. VMware ThinApp進(jìn)行程序安裝后的系統(tǒng)快照掃描

掃描完成后將會(huì)提示選擇程序入口點(diǎn),即從哪個(gè)程序開始啟動(dòng),一般就是主程序文件,通常ThinApp會(huì)自動(dòng)選擇好,點(diǎn)擊Next繼續(xù)。

5. 進(jìn)入Sandbox Location設(shè)置,Sandbox是Thinapp的沙盤或緩存目錄,及程序所作更改的保存路徑,以后再運(yùn)行封裝的程序時(shí)會(huì)從Sandbox中讀取配置信息,如果刪除Sandbox的話,程序就會(huì)復(fù)原為默認(rèn)狀態(tài)(即快照時(shí)的狀態(tài));

VMware ThinApp提供了三種模式:
    *  User's profile (%AppData%\Thinstall目錄就是系統(tǒng)的Application Data目錄;
    *  USB flash / portable media 就是將Sandbox保存到exe文件所在路徑,即相當(dāng)于制作便攜軟件了、Sandbox路徑就跟封裝出的程序在同一個(gè)目錄中。

6. 點(diǎn)擊Next進(jìn)入System Isolation模式設(shè)置;所謂的Isolation modes就是設(shè)置虛擬程序所做的更改如何影響到實(shí)際的計(jì)算機(jī)環(huán)境

Merged isolation mode(合并模式)允許虛擬程序在實(shí)際的文件系統(tǒng)中保存文件(如c:\user路徑,但系統(tǒng)目錄除外)、或者說封裝后的程序(Thinstalled App)對(duì)文件系統(tǒng)的更改是合并進(jìn)現(xiàn)有的文件系統(tǒng)的;

而選擇WriteCopy isolation mode模式后,虛擬程序所作的更改只會(huì)保存到桌面和文檔目錄,而保存到其他目錄(如c:\user)是不可見的(被重定向并保存到到了Sandbox中),或者說封裝后的程序?qū)ξ募到y(tǒng)的更改將不會(huì)在實(shí)際的文件系統(tǒng)中可見,轉(zhuǎn)而保存到Sandbox中,如處理后的圖片等。這里Merged isolation mode用的比較多。

7. 點(diǎn)擊Next繼續(xù),這里可以設(shè)置Thinapp工程文件的保存路徑,還可以設(shè)置封裝時(shí)的壓縮模式(Compression);

No compression即為不壓縮, Fast compression為快速壓縮模式;建議選擇Fast compression ,能提供57%的壓縮率,而程序啟動(dòng)時(shí)間跟No compression相差不多,就是第一次封裝的時(shí)候時(shí)間較長。

點(diǎn)擊Next后VMware ThinApp開始保存工程文件:

8. 保存完之后,你有兩個(gè)選擇: Build Now直接以默認(rèn)參數(shù)生成虛擬化程序,或Browse Project返回到工程文件目錄自定義更多高級(jí)選項(xiàng)。

這是直接選擇Build Now后的情況,最后會(huì)提示Build Complete,封裝后的程序在工程目錄的bin文件夾中:

9. 選擇Browse Project瀏覽到工程文件目錄。在這里可以刪除一些不必要的文件以減少封裝后的文件大小,如刪除幫助文件、卸載程序等;而這里的Package.ini就是封裝參數(shù)配置文件,由build.bat調(diào)用,我在這里說明一下常用的參數(shù)。修改參數(shù)后重新運(yùn)行build.bat即可生成虛擬化程序。

壓縮和分離模式,這在前面的向?qū)б呀?jīng)設(shè)置過了,如果不滿意地方,也可以直接在Package.ini中更改:

可選項(xiàng)有:
NoneCompressionType=None
CompressionType=Fast
DirectoryIsolationMode=Merged
DirectoryIsolationMode=WriteCopy

SandboxPath設(shè)置:SandboxPath即Sandbox路徑,SandboxPath即可以用相對(duì)路徑,也可用絕對(duì)路徑。


SandboxPath=. (EXE文件相同路徑下)
SandboxPath=%AppData%\Thinstall (系統(tǒng)的AppData\Thinstall目錄)
SandboxPath=LocalSandbox\Subdir1(EXE文件目錄下的子目錄)
SandboxPath=Z:\Sandboxes

OutDir即打包程序的輸出目錄,不做過多介紹。

SandboxName即Sandbox的目錄名,最好設(shè)置為一個(gè)更好的名字,默認(rèn)是軟件名。

RemoveSandboxOnExit:程序結(jié)束時(shí)是否刪除Sandbox。
RemoveSandboxOnExit=1 (刪除Sandbox)
RemoveSandboxOnExit=0 (不刪除Sandbox)

VirtualDrives:這里保存的是快照時(shí)系統(tǒng)的驅(qū)動(dòng)器狀態(tài),包括類型、序列號(hào)等信息,以便運(yùn)行虛擬程序時(shí)創(chuàng)建虛擬的驅(qū)動(dòng)器狀態(tài),我的經(jīng)驗(yàn)是最好是在一個(gè)虛擬機(jī)中做快照,且不要有太多分區(qū)。

以上就是一些常用的Thinapp封裝參數(shù),當(dāng)然不止這些,還有很多很多高級(jí)的選項(xiàng),需要的請(qǐng)自己參考幫助文件吧,說明都很詳細(xì),特別是ThinApp Scripts功能,可以在程序啟動(dòng)或結(jié)束時(shí)運(yùn)行批處理或VBS腳本,這樣就能實(shí)現(xiàn)更多的功能了。需要說明的是VMware ThinApp并不是適合每一個(gè)程序,有的封裝后就不能運(yùn)行,只能是通過ThinApp的升級(jí)來修復(fù)bug、支持更多的軟件;強(qiáng)烈建議在一個(gè)干凈的系統(tǒng)環(huán)境中使用VMware ThinApp。我現(xiàn)在對(duì)單文件軟件不是怎么感興趣,VMware ThinApp也用的少多了,不過還是希望能與大家多交流交流。

現(xiàn)在Picasa相冊(cè)不能訪問,導(dǎo)致博客頁面極不美觀,想要恢復(fù)Picasa圖片顯示的可以如下操作:

在Hosts文件里加入:
203.208.39.104 picasaweb.google.com
203.208.39.99 lh1.ggpht.com
203.208.39.99 lh2.ggpht.com
203.208.39.99 lh3.ggpht.com
203.208.39.99 lh4.ggpht.com
203.208.39.99 lh5.ggpht.com
203.208.39.99 lh6.ggpht.com

詳細(xì)的設(shè)置方法可參考:Google Picasa相冊(cè)不能訪問的解決辦法。

本站僅提供存儲(chǔ)服務(wù),所有內(nèi)容均由用戶發(fā)布,如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請(qǐng)點(diǎn)擊舉報(bào)。
打開APP,閱讀全文并永久保存 查看更多類似文章
猜你喜歡
類似文章
應(yīng)用程序虛擬化
虛擬機(jī)VMware Tools安裝方法以及創(chuàng)建快照_乘風(fēng)軒舞
VMware ThinApp 4.7.3綠色版
三種VMware數(shù)據(jù)備份和恢復(fù)方法
在Win10上跑虛擬機(jī),用VBox好還是VMware好或者其他的?
《應(yīng)用程序虛擬化及部署工具》(VMware ThinApp?)
更多類似文章 >>
生活服務(wù)
分享 收藏 導(dǎo)長圖 關(guān)注 下載文章
綁定賬號(hào)成功
后續(xù)可登錄賬號(hào)暢享VIP特權(quán)!
如果VIP功能使用有故障,
可點(diǎn)擊這里聯(lián)系客服!

聯(lián)系客服